AIM
To assess the effects of hepatitis E virus (HEV) on the
production of typeⅠ interferons (IFNs) and determine the
underlying mechanisms.
METHODS
We measured the production of interferon (IFN)-alpha
and -beta (-α/β) in genotype 3 HEV-infected C3A cells
at different time points (0, 8, 12, 24, 48, 72 and 120 h)
by enzyme-linked immunosorbent assay (ELISA). The
expression levels of IFN-stimulated gene (ISG)15 in HEVinfected C3A cells at different time points were tested by
western blotting. The plasmid-expressing open reading
frame 3 (ORF3) or control plasmids (green fluorescent
protein-expressing) were transfected into C3A cells,
and the levels of IFN-α/β and ISG15 were evaluated,
respectively. Furthermore, the plasmid-expressing ISG15
or small interfering RNA-inhibiting ISG15 was transfected
into infected C3A cells. Then, the production of IFN-α/β
was also measured by ELISA.
RESULTS
We showed that genotype 3 HEV could enhance the
production of IFN-α/β and induce elevation of ISG15 in
C3A cells. HEV ORF3 protein could enhance the production of IFN-α/β and the expression of ISG15. Additionally,
ISG15 silencing enhanced the production of IFN-α/β.
Overexpression of ISG15 resulted in the reduction of
IFN-α/β.
CONCLUSION
HEV may promote production of IFN-α/β and expression
of ISG15 via ORF3 in the early stages, and increased
ISG15 subsequently inhibited the production of IFN-α/β.
